- Note
- Ocean Front Walk was developed in the early 1900s along with the rest of the Venice area, then a part of the city of Ocean Park. The Thompson Scenic Railway was a roller coaster built in 1910 by the L. A. Thompson Company. Located at the west end of Ocean Front Walk on the north end of the Venice Pier, it extended out into the ocean on the west end and featured mountain scenery at the east end. The ride was removed in 1919.
